FSSAI has developed State Food Safety Index to measure the performance of states on various parameters of Food Safety. This index is based on the performance of State/ UT on five significant parameters, namely, Human Resources and Institutional Data, Compliance, Food Testing – Infrastructure and Surveillance, Training & Capacity Building, and Consumer Empowerment. The Index is a dynamic quantitative and qualitative benchmarking model that provides an objective framework for evaluating food safety across all States/UTs.
4th State Food Safety Index (2021-2022)
- Tamil Nadu topped the State Food Safety Index (SFSI) this year, followed by Gujarat and Maharashtra
- Among the smaller states, Goa stood first, followed by Manipur and Sikkim
- Among the Union Territories, Jammu and Kashmir, Delhi and Chandigarh secured the first, second and third ranks
